Meriwether County School System’s Dress Code
Meriwether County School System developed the dress code policy. The following policy allows students to dress for success while attending Meriwether County Schools:
The Meriwether County School System's dress code will consist of the following for Pre-K through 12th grade:
Shorts need to be to the top of the knee.
Skirts need to be to the top of the knee.
Dresses need to be to the top of the knee.
No athletic shorts
No excessive tight or form fitting clothing (i.e. dresses, pants, skirts)
All tops need to have a neckline no lower than the armpit.
No halter-tops, tank tops, tube tops, strapless shirts, or spaghetti straps, etc.
Shirts cannot be see-through.
No bra straps showing at any time.
No leggings/jeggings in middle and high schools
No Yoga pants, sweatpants or joggers
No undergarments may be showing.
No pajamas
No body cleavage or midriff may be showing.
No holes in jeans, shirts, dress, or any garment worn on the body that exposes bare skin.
No hats or caps may be worn in the building.
Sweatshirts, light sweaters, and light jackets are highly encouraged during the colder months. No bulky jackets or jackets with more than two pockets will be allowed. This includes the inside and outside the jacket.
No Hoodies at all
No ski masks
Clear book bags are required
Any clothing with inappropriate (profane, vulgar, sexual, racial, ethical, alcohol, drugs and tobacco, gang related signs or words, sayings, slogans or graphics will not be allowed.
No SAGGING. Pants must be worn up on the waist.
No solid colors can be worn for an entire outfit. For example, students will not be able to wear all red, blue, white, or black. Students cannot wear a red shirt, red pants, and red shoes. This could be considered gang affiliation.
No flip-flops, open toe shoes, slippers/house shoes, heels above 3 inches
Closed-toed sandals may be worn; however, MCSS prefer closed-toed sandals have a strap on the back.
No blankets

The Meriwether County School District does not discriminate on the basis of race, color, religion, national origin, age, disability, or sex in its employment practices, student programs and dealings with the public. It is the policy of the Board of Education to comply fully with the requirements of Title VI, Title IX, Section 504 of the Rehabilitation Act of 1973, the Americans With Disabilities Act and all accompanying regulations.
